Junior Hockey Assistant Coach (Intern) - Caledon Golden Hawks (PJHL)



The Caledon Golden Hawks are seeking a motivated

Junior Assistant Coach (Intern)

to join our staff for the upcoming PJHL season. This role is designed for individuals who aspire to coach at the Junior level and want hands-on experience in all aspects of team operations. You'll work directly with the Head Coach, Assistant Coaches, and General Manager to gain valuable exposure to player development, game preparation, and day-to-day hockey operations.

This is an entry-level coaching role with real responsibilities -- perfect for someone who wants to build their resume and prepare for future coaching opportunities in Junior, AAA, or higher levels of hockey.

Key Responsibilities



Assist the coaching staff with

practice planning, setup, and execution

. Support the team in

video review, statistics tracking, and opponent scouting reports

. Be actively involved in

game-day operations

, including warmups, bench support, and post-game breakdown. Provide individual feedback to players under the direction of senior coaches. Help with

player communication and team logistics

to ensure smooth operations. Participate in coaches' meetings, learning firsthand how decisions are made at the Junior level.
